ISSUE STATEMENT

 

Approving an ordinance ascertaining the prevailing rate of wages for laborers, workman, and mechanics employed on Public Works projects for the City of Darien, County of DuPage, Illinois.

 

ORDINANCE

 

BACKGROUND/HISTORY

 

Annually, the state law requires that municipalities ascertain the prevailing wages to be paid on Public Works projects within the community. The State of Illinois provides the last listing of the prevailing rates and it then becomes the City’s responsibility to accept and publish these rates for future construction projects of the City. An ordinance has been developed, as in past years, to certify the prevailing wage rates for the coming year that has been received from the Illinois Department of Labor which is dated May 2011.

 

COMMITTEE RECOMMENDATION

 

The State requires the annual approval of the prevailing wage rates as published by the State of Illinois and, as such, the Municipal Services Committee recommends acceptance of these rates.
